The SpaceX IPO Effect on Venture Capital

from The Venture Capital Podcast with Fexingo: VCs, Term Sheets, and Startup Investing · host Fexingo

SpaceX went public today after years of speculation. Lucas and Luna break down what the IPO means for venture capital — how a massive, high-profile debut reshapes term sheets, valuation expectations, and the pace of later-stage investing. They look at the ripple effects on private market comps, the pressure on VCs to get into high-growth names before they hit the public market, and what it signals for other pre-IPO giants like Mistral, which is rumored to be raising at a €20 billion valuation.
